Abstract

The invention provides an injection molding machine with double ejection rod apparatuses. The machine comprises a fixed mold plate and a movable mold plate. The fixed plate comprises double ejection aligning ports. The movable mold plate comprises double ejection rod apparatuses corresponding to the double ejection aligning ports. The double ejection rod apparatuses comprise two driving screws, a driving motor and an adjusting mechanism. The driving screws are used for adjusting the space between the double ejection rod apparatuses. The driving motor comprises a driving belt pulley used for transmitting the power required by the double ejection rod apparatuses. The adjusting mechanism is used for adjusting the position of the driving motor, such that the power output of the driving motor under different double ejection rod apparatus spaces is maintained. With the double ejection rod apparatuses provided by the invention, ejection molding can be simultaneously carried out upon two sets of molds, such that the utilization rate of the ejection molding machine is high.
